可靠不确定性估计对安全敏感应用至关重要,需区分认知不确定性与随机不确定性,但现有文献定义不一,难以评估方法准确性。由于真实认知不确定性通常不可知,现有评估多依赖分布外检测等代理任务,无法提供完整真值且难以洞察不确定性结构。本文提出将不确定性统一定义为点态后验风险——在给定数据下,合理真实函数分布上预测器的期望损失。该视角结合贝叶斯函数不确定性与估计器偏离后验均值的偏差,涵盖模型误设与优化误差。基于此构建理论支持的基准,利用具有真实协变量和已知生成过程的半合成数据,可直接计算理想认知与随机不确定性。避免代理评估,实现对不确定性估计的细粒度分析。实验发现:高预测精度并不保证不确定性拆分可靠。基准揭示了不同方法间实际差异,识别出与理想目标对齐的方法,并暴露其对数据集和建模选择的敏感性。
原文摘要 · Abstract (English)
Reliable uncertainty estimates are critical in safety-sensitive applications, where understanding the sources of predictive uncertainty is essential. This often requires disentangling epistemic uncertainty from aleatoric uncertainty, yet these uncertainty types are not defined consistently across the literature, making it difficult to assess whether a method produces accurate uncertainty estimates. Evaluation is further complicated by the fact that ground-truth epistemic uncertainty is typically unavailable. Existing benchmarks therefore mostly rely on proxy tasks such as out-of-distribution detection, which do not provide complete ground-truth uncertainty targets and offer limited insight into the structure and quality of uncertainty estimates. We propose a unified definition of uncertainty as pointwise posterior risk, the expected loss of a predictor under the distribution of plausible ground-truth functions given the data. This view combines Bayesian uncertainty over functions with estimator-dependent deviations from the posterior mean, capturing effects such as misspecification and optimization error. This formulation constitutes the foundation of a theory-backed benchmark that enables direct computation of oracle epistemic and aleatoric uncertainty using semi-synthetic datasets with real covariates and known generative processes. By avoiding proxy evaluations, the benchmark enables fine-grained analysis of uncertainty estimates. Empirically, we find that accurate prediction does not guarantee reliable uncertainty disentanglement. The benchmark reveals practically useful differences between methods, identifying approaches with meaningful alignment to oracle uncertainty targets while exposing sensitivity to datasets and modeling choices.
